Splet20. apr. 2014 · In ancient Hebrew, however, נֵס (nes) can mean a flag, a sign or an ensign ( Jer. 51:12; Is. 49:22 ). However, it is more nuanced than that. The word נִסִּי (nissi) “my banner” is connected by its root to verb לָשֵׂאת (laset) which means to carry, to lift, to raise up. This verb נָשָׂא (nasa) appears in many biblical ...

Splet13. jan. 2024 · Adonai Nissi occurs only once in the Bible. It is translated as The LORD (is) My Banner. It can also be interpreted as The LORD My Miracle, The LORD My Refuge. Nes (nês), a Hebrew word from which Nissi derived, means a pole with an insignia attached, banner, standard, ensign, signal, sign, and miracle.
